Western Union Spam Delivers Keylogger
A new wave of spam claiming to be a money transfer notice from western union is delivering a nasty piece of malware-a keylogger. The email claims over $3,000 has been transferred to the recipient and includes a tracking number. The keylogger is contained in a Trojan posing as a transfer sheet attached to the email. When downloaded it captures personal information such as usernames and passwords and sends them to a hotpop.com address. The attack isn't very sophisticated-the attachment is an .exe file which most users know better than to open and most email clients block by default.
